In the realm of celestial events, the Winter Solstice holds a special place. It marks the shortest day and longest night of the year, a time when the sun's journey reaches its southernmost point. If you're curious about when this significant day falls, here's a simple way to inquire: "Can you check which day is the Winter Solstice?"

The Winter Solstice typically occurs around December 21st or 22nd, depending on the year. It's a time for reflection, celebration, and the promise of longer days ahead. Many cultures have their own traditions and rituals to honor this day, from lighting candles to feasting with family and friends.
